Gain the best results from your efforts in landscaping by designing yourself a multi-seasonal garden. Choose an array of plants that burst with blooms at different times of the year, making sure they are appropriate for your zone. Evergreen trees and exotic tree species with notable foliage can also help preserve your landscape’s year-round appeal.

For a nice update to your yard, consider re-edging rock beds or flower areas with soft curves. Curved beds are more contemporary and up-to-date than sharp corners and straight lines. This is an inexpensive way to give a more contemporary appearance to your garden.

Your choice of plants will be critical in determining the success or failure of your landscaping efforts. Don’t plant things in shady areas if they require much sunlight. Also, you should not put a tree in an area where it cannot grow. Take the time to ensure your plants can thrive in their new home.

Ground Cover

If your yard features a sizable tree, it may be tough to grow flowers beneath it. Rather then putting in flowers, think about putting in a ground cover. This will make your yard look nicer and it’s very simple to care for. Some excellent options for ground cover are hosta and sweet woodruff.

Try using curved edges when landscaping your yard. Curves are more visually appealing and can add interest and depth to your yard. When your property is viewed from the street, the curved lines of the borders in your landscaping will help to soften the straight lines of the hardscape elements, like your house and driveway.

Go ahead and add in more than one or two different kinds of plants in your landscape. This is a vital thing to do to protect your lawn from insects and diseases. If plants of the same type are used, they may all perish in such an episode. Diversity in plant life is an important part of landscaping.

Prior to undertaking any landscape project, estimate the costs. Make a complete list of every item that you may need. Then decide where you want to or should buy the materials you need. Even the same retailer will have different prices depending on where it’s located. Find out how you can acquire quality materials for lower prices.

If you are planning to hire a professional landscaper to design your yard, be sure to ask for references. Price is very important, but so is quality. Being able to see properties that the landscaper completed will give you a better idea if the landscaper is a good fit for your needs.

Plants, trees and foliage can give your landscape project a feeling of continuity. Some plants only blossom for short periods of time, so some seasons you can have a dull garden. To keep your yard green, use evergreen and foliage plants between the beds of plants.

If landscaping on a budget is what you’re considering then remember that the entire project can be broken down into segments. Nothing is bad about scheduling your project during certain seasons. This makes financing the project much more doable. Just write down each step in your process, and then choose the ones that are most important to finish first.

To develop a landscape that requires the least amount of work while giving the most natural and hardy results, choose native plants. Plants that have been able to survive in the wild have proven that they can easily thrive in the climate conditions available, and therefore,they will be easier for you to maintain. The upkeep of these local plants will be less as well, which can save you money on water bills.

When you are thinking of doing some landscaping, consider the amount of water that you are going to need and the climate that you are growing in. In many areas of the country, water restrictions have been put in place because of shortages, so try to choose plants that will not use a lot of water, and will grow in the temperatures that you live in.

A landscape design will save you both time and money. Consider starting with a rough sketch and then use that sketch to determine what materials you will need. By having a materials list you can avoid impulse buying.
